📖Generation guide

First Generation YK1 • 2006-2014

Powered by the J35 V6 engine, this generation features a 5-speed automatic, with later models offering a 6-speed. It introduced the in-bed trunk and full-time AWD for improved handling.

Second Generation YK2 • 2017-2026

Continuing the legacy, this version upgrades to a 6-speed and later 9-speed automatic transmission. It includes i-VTM4 AWD, a widened bed, and premium trims like the Black Edition.

Known issues by generation

When considering a donation, it's important to be aware of some model-specific concerns. The first-generation Ridgelines (2006-2014) are known for issues with the J35 VCM system leading to lifter failure, particularly in the 2007-2009 models. The second-generation (2017-present) has faced complaints about the 9-speed ZF 9HP transmission shudder and harsh shifting as well as stuck-mode failures in the AWD coupling actuator. Additionally, drainage clogs in the in-bed trunk can lead to standing water, affecting usability. While these unibody pickups offer a more comfortable ride compared to body-on-frame counterparts, they come with trade-offs in towing capacity and payload which potential donors should consider.

Donation value by condition + generation

In terms of donation value, the Ridgeline's worth can vary significantly depending on trim level and condition. Trims like the Black Edition and RTL-E often command a premium due to their sought-after features and aesthetics. All-wheel-drive models generally hold higher resale values compared to their front-wheel-drive counterparts. While hybrid or turbo options may be rare, they can significantly increase appraisal values.
